Sputnik is a news agency and radio network with multimedia news hubs in dozens of countries. It is owned and operated by the Russian government-controlled news agency Rossiya Segodnya. Sputnik's content is often seen as reflecting the Russian government's official position on international affairs, and it has been accused of disseminating pro-Russian propaganda. Sputnik's coverage includes a wide range of topics, from politics and economics to culture and science. It provides news in multiple languages, including English, Spanish, Arabic, and Chinese, among others. The agency aims to offer an alternative perspective on global events, countering what it perceives as biased or one-sided reporting in Western media. Critics of Sputnik argue that it serves as a tool for Russian propaganda and disinformation, particularly in the context of international conflicts involving Russia, such as the annexation of Crimea and the war in Ukraine. Some Western governments and media watchdogs have labeled Sputnik as a purveyor of fake news and propaganda.
